明治四十二年 (1909) 5 yen Values

Details

Obverse: Japanese text; Takeuchi no Sukune (legendary hero and god); Ube shrine in Tottori

Reverse: English and Japanese text; rosettes; exchange clause

Basic Information

GSID:

114893

Denomination:

5 yen

Varieties and Classification

Variety:

明治四十二年 (1909)

Design Details

Note Color:

Black, light green, and orange

Note Dimension:

146 x 85 mm

Printer:

局刷印府政国帝本日大 (Greater Japan Imperial Government Printing Bureau)
